As speech accumulates, increasingly rich speaker information becomes available through acoustic, prosodic, and linguistic cues, potentially challenging speaker anonymization methods that primarily target vocal characteristics. We investigate ASV in a multi-utterance, multimodal setting and examine whether aggregating information across anonymized speech impacts privacy.
